Indian Law Institute LLM Eligibility & Highlights 2025
The Indian Law Institute LLM is a one-year full-time course that is structured to offer an intensive legal education. Candidates applying for the Indian Law Institute LLM admission are to satisfy certain criteria as per eligibility conditions. Selected candidates have to go through the counselling process for seat allotment after meeting the eligibility criteria. The rigorous selection process means that only high-calibre talent is accepted to the programme, preserving its level of standard. Candidates can refer to the following Indian Law Institute LLM eligibility criteria:
| Course Name | Eligibility Criteria | Selection Criteria |
|---|---|---|
| Master of Law (LLM) | LLB degree with at least 50% aggregate from any University/Institution recognised by the Bar Council of India to be eligible. | ILICAT + Publication / Research/ Writing Skill |
| A three-year Law degree from a foreign university with at least 50% aggregate or an equivalent grade as per AIU norms. |
NOTE: Applicants who take part in the qualifying exams can also apply; however, their admission is contingent upon providing evidence of meeting the required qualifications at the time of enrollment.

Indian Law Institute LLM Fees 2025
Candidates applying for ILI courses must pay the respective course fee to confirm their seats after selection. The ILI fee structure compares various components that are either one-time chargeable or payable on an annual/semester basis. Candidates can refer to the below table for Indian Law Institute LLM fee bifurcation:
| Fee component | Amount |
|---|---|
| Tuition Fee | INR 1.38 lakh |
| University Enrolment Fee | INR 2,000 |
| Security Deposit | INR 5,000 |
| Examination Fee | INR 5,000 |
NOTE: The above-mentioned fee is taken from the official website/sanctioning body. It is still subject to changes and hence, is indicative.

Indian Law Institute LL.M.Indian Law Institute LLM Seats 2025
53 seats are available in total at ILI for LLM program. These seats are assigned on various factors, like the number of seats available, the number of candidates selected, and on entrance examination scores etc. The seat allotment for LLM programme at ILI is done through ILICAT counselling.
This selection process makes the admissions process centralised and crystal clear.
Refer to the following highlights for more information about LLM seat intake at ILI mentioned below -
| Courses | Seats |
|---|---|
| Master of Law (LL.M) | 53 |

Indian Law Institute LLM Placements
Indian Law Institute LLM placement 2024 has been released. As per the NIRF report 2024 released by the Indian Law Institute, the ILI LLM median package offered during the placements in 2023 stood at INR 5.4 LPA. Further, a total of 112 students were placed and 34 students opted for higher studies out of a total of 157 students during PG 1-year placements 2023. Earlier, according to the Indian Law Institute NIRF report 2023, the median package offered during Indian Law Institute PG 1-year placements 2022 stood at INR 5.75 LPA. Further, a total of 138 students out of 192 students were placed during Indian Law Institute PG 1-year placements in 2022.
